  "account": "The Reserve Bank of New Zealand (RBNZ) is poised to increase interest rates for a second time, with a 25 basis points hike to 2.75%, according to BNY's Geoff Yu. This move is driven by elevated inflation and strong business and consumer confidence data. The RBNZ had previously forecast the OCR to reach 3.0% by Q1 2027 and continue to rise to 3.3% in the medium term. However, markets now anticipate the rate to be around 3.25% by March 2027. The upcoming decision by the RBNZ is a primary focus, with investors closely monitoring the updated macroeconomic forecasts and the Official Cash Rate track.",
